We departed Torbay Airfield in the early morning hours Monday with a stopover in Toronto. From there we headed to the sunny south, final destination: Jamaica!

 

 

Travelling with Sandra and I were good buddies Natasha, Cory and their two kids. We were all super excited for sunny skies, warm temps and white sandy beaches, a welcome break from the rain drizzle and fog back home!

 

 

 

 

 

We landed at Sangster International Airport in Montego Bay around 2pm local time then boarded our bus for the 1.5 hour ride Eastbound to our resort, Bahia Principe Grand in Runaway Bay.

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

Our bus stopped at two other resorts along the way to get other Air Canada Vacation passengers to their vacation destinations.

 

 

 

 

 

 

Bahia Principe is the largest hotel/resort in the country, it's also located on a much nicer part of the island nation than the first two resorts we dropped passengers off at.

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

Our room was impressive, spacious and very well appointed with a couch, king size bed and great washroom facilities.

Supper was at the Jasmine buffet which usually reserved for the Luxury (adult only) side guests but this month was open to everyone as the grand side buffet was under renovation.

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

The shops at the Village were our favourite shops at the resort. The staff were much friendlier & helpful and prices much better than the shops inside the main resort building.

 

 

Evening entertainment was usually held on the terrace outside the lobby bar featuring musical acts of all description.

After supper we headed to the lobby bar which is beautiful, bright and air conditioned! We started out with Yahtzee before turning our attention to the pool tables.

 

 

The tables were old, well used and had a hard life in a very humid environment. There were just two cues, one for each of the two tables, the balls were a mismatched mess, and the poor piece of chalk left a lot to be desired.

 

 

However we made the best of it, racked the balls and started the inaugural Runaway Bay Fall Open 8-ball championships.

 

 

The tables had more runs than a Mexican restaurant on Taco Tuesday but we rose to the challenge  and we had a ball playing on these relics.

 

 

 

 

 

In the end I won because I'm relaying the story, Cory was the close runner up while Tash and Sandra tied for 3rd.
